CVE-2022-27593: QNAP Photo Station Externally Controlled Reference Vulnerability

First published: Thu Sep 08 2022(Updated: )

Certain QNAP NAS running Photo Station with internet exposure contain an externally controlled reference to a resource vulnerability which can allow an attacker to modify system files. This vulnerability was observed being utilized in a Deadbolt ransomware campaign.
